I found this brilliant interactive campaign on MIT Advertising Blog. A great example of how the internet can bring immersive experiences in the real world:
MIT Advertising Lab: "Last year, I wrote about how all the pieces were already in place to create Minority Report style billboards that address shoppers by name. Today, fiction has become reality in a test run by MINI: "The idea is simple, first give MINI USA some irreverent information about yourself (nothing too personal). MINI USA then sends out a special keyfob (4-6 weeks after sign-up) that identifies you to each of the Motorboards you pass. When the boards detect that you are about the drive by, they deliver a personal message based on the information you originally gave."
